22 // Access a PersistentMemoryAllocator for storing histograms in space that | |
23 // can be persisted or shared between processes. There is only ever one | |
24 // allocator for all such histograms created by a single process though one | |
25 // process may access the histograms created by other processes if it has a | |
26 // handle on its memory segment. This takes ownership of the object and | |
27 // should not be changed without great care as it is likely that there will | |
28 // be pointers to data held in that space. It should be called as soon as | |
29 // possible during startup to capture as many histograms as possible and | |
30 // while operating single-threaded so there are no race-conditions. | |
31 BASE_EXPORT void SetPersistentHistogramMemoryAllocator( | |
32 PersistentMemoryAllocator* allocator); | |
33 BASE_EXPORT PersistentMemoryAllocator* GetPersistentHistogramMemoryAllocator(); | |

42 // Recreate a Histogram from data held in persistent memory. Though this | |
43 // object will be local to the current process, the sample data will be | |
44 // shared with all other threads referencing it. This method takes a |ref| | |
45 // to the top- level histogram data and the |allocator| on which it is found. | |
46 // This method will return nullptr if any problem is detected with the data. | |
47 // The |allocator| may or may not be the same as the PersistentMemoryAllocator | |
48 // set for general use so that this method can be used to extract Histograms | |
49 // from persistent memory segments other than the default place that this | |
50 // process is creating its own histograms. The caller must take ownership of | |
51 // the returned object and destroy it when no longer needed. | |
52 BASE_EXPORT HistogramBase* GetPersistentHistogram( | |
53 PersistentMemoryAllocator* allocator, | |
54 int32_t ref); | |

81 // Import new histograms from attached PersistentMemoryAllocator. It's | |
82 // possible for other processes to create histograms in the attached memory | |
83 // segment; this adds those to the internal list of known histograms to | |
84 // avoid creating duplicates that would have to merged during reporting. | |
85 // Every call to this method resumes from the last entry it saw so it costs | |
86 // nothing if nothing new has been added. | |
87 void ImportPersistentHistograms(); | |
